Star Wars and XCOM fans are buzzing! We finally have a release date for the highly anticipated tactical strategy game Star Wars Zero Company.

Following a brief pre-show leak, publisher Electronic Arts, along with developers Bit Reactor and Respawn Entertainment, officially confirmed during Summer Game Fest that the game will launch on August 27, 2026.

The single-player, turn-based tactics game will be available for PlayStation 5, Xbox Series X/S, and PC (via both Steam and the Epic Games Store). Surprising PlayStation didn’t try and squeeze this in in the State of Play.


Star Wars Zero Company

Set during the chaotic twilight of the Clone Wars era, Star Wars Zero Company puts players in the boots of Hawks, a former Galactic Republic officer.

You are tasked with leading an unconventional, customisable squad of mercenaries, misfits, and operatives recruited from across the galaxy to fight an emerging threat.

Developed by a team at Bit Reactor featuring seasoned XCOM veterans (including director Greg Foertsch) the game aims to blend deep, grid-based tactical combat with high-stakes mechanics.


Notably, the game features a permadeath system for your squad mates, leaning heavily into the narrative theme that “Star Wars is about loss.”

However, it isn’t just a menu-heavy strategy clone. Outside of combat, players will be able to explore the galaxy in a third-person action style, driving a story-centric experience that developers have compared to RPG-heavy frameworks like Mass Effect or Baldur’s Gate 3.

Familiar faces, including Jedi General Anakin Skywalker, are also confirmed to make appearances.

Pricing and Pre-Order Tiers

Electronic Arts has opted for a tiered pricing structure that slightly favours PC players over console users. Pre-orders are officially open across all platforms:

  • PC (Steam/Epic Games Store): $49.99 for the Standard Edition / $59.99 for the Deluxe Edition.
  • Consoles (PS5/Xbox Series X/S): $59.99 for the Standard Edition / $69.99 for the Deluxe Edition.

While the digital-only Deluxe Edition won’t offer early access, it comes packed with extensive cosmetic rewards.

According to the official Steam listing, pre-purchasing the Deluxe Edition unlocks the “Grand Army of the Republic” cosmetic pack (featuring Republic Officer, 100th Clone Company, and ARC Trooper armour sets), a “Shadow Collective” pack (complete with a Pyke exo-helmet and syndicalist faction tattoos), and five distinct weapon theme sets.


A Smart Scheduling Move

Dropping on August 27 puts Star Wars Zero Company in an enviable position.

The late August slot allows the game to get ahead of an incredibly dense September 2026 release calendar, which already boasts massive heavy-hitters like Marvel’s Wolverine, Dune: Awakening, Warhammer 40,000: Dawn of War 4, and The Blood of Dawnwalker.
